South Australia Speech and Hearing Centre (SASHC)

Your go-to destination for all your communication needs

SASHC in Adelaide is an independent service provider for the provision of speech & language assessments and intervention, hearing assessments in both adults and children, auditory processing disorder (APD) assessments and intervention. We also take pride in specialising in the provision of hearing services, both hearing aids and rehabilitation in adults. SASHC is owned and run by a passionate, dual qualified, speech pathologist and audiologist experienced in working with children and adults. We utilise the most recent evidence-based therapies and technologies in all our assessments and interventions.

Hearing devices

In addition to our diagnostic and therapeutic services, we provide hearing devices for those in need. These devices include hearing aids, amplification devices for APD, hearables for mild hearing losses and ear and hearing protection options.
